Scratches on a smartphone screen reveal the story of drops, drags, and daily wear. For refurbishers, those marks have resulted in additional hours of disassembly, glass replacement, and reassembly, which has cost them time and money. This is where the TBK-938 Intelligent Polishing Machine comes in, a Shenzhen-made piece of machinery that completes the task in a single sealed, slurry-fed operation.



Wang of TBK talks us through the procedure. Begin with the phone in hand, say an iPhone with a new key scratch across the screen. A short scratch for demonstration reasons, but in real life, it’s whatever damage the item comes with. Next, apply a bead of UV-curable glue to the edges, ports, and buttons. This isn’t a fancy adhesive; it’s a simple compound designed to protect electronics and applied precisely using a CNC mill. The glue hardens under a UV lamp in only a minute, forming a barrier that keeps the muck out of the internals.

That barrier is important since polishing requires grit and water. Once cured, use a razor blade to remove any excess liquid from the screen’s surface. The phone is then placed in a custom mold; TBK has molds for various models including older iPhones and 14 or 15. This allows for 4 phones to be stored upside down and securely at the same time. A scoop of polishing compound is added, then water, which the machine mixes into a fine slurry. The top closes and the water mill spins for 15-20 minutes. Rollers apply adjustable air pressure, various speeds for abrasion. Circulation ensures the liquid flows evenly, a quiet pump handles the rest with minimal noise.

Open the chamber and the scratches are gone, leaving the surface factory fresh. Best of all, there’s no glass thinning; the process removes just enough material to fix the defect without compromising strength. Kevin from TBK demos the whole device but swap the mold and it also works on loose screens which is handy for bulk jobs where screens are sent separately. What was the result? A phone that passes inspection and is ready to resell for full value.

This was built by TBK engineers with the refurbishment business in mind. Traditional methods involve extracting the screen, bonding new cover glass and testing for problems which can take hours per device. Here the whole process including prep and clean up takes less than 30 minutes. 1000 watts in a 700x700x1200mm area, global voltage options. Operators can control the depth of scratches from light scratches to deep gouges with stepless pressure and speed adjustments. The liquid system recycles abrasive and eliminates waste, the mold provides even contact without wobbling.
